Luke Caldwell is a scholar working on Atomic and Molecular Physics, and Optics, Artificial Intelligence and Nuclear and High Energy Physics. According to data from OpenAlex, Luke Caldwell has authored 14 papers receiving a total of 843 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Atomic and Molecular Physics, and Optics, 5 papers in Artificial Intelligence and 2 papers in Nuclear and High Energy Physics. Recurrent topics in Luke Caldwell’s work include Cold Atom Physics and Bose-Einstein Condensates (11 papers), Atomic and Subatomic Physics Research (7 papers) and Advanced Frequency and Time Standards (6 papers). Luke Caldwell is often cited by papers focused on Cold Atom Physics and Bose-Einstein Condensates (11 papers), Atomic and Subatomic Physics Research (7 papers) and Advanced Frequency and Time Standards (6 papers). Luke Caldwell collaborates with scholars based in United Kingdom, United States and Spain. Luke Caldwell's co-authors include M. R. Tarbutt, B. E. Sauer, H. J. Williams, N. J. Fitch, Stefan Truppe, Moritz Hambach, E. A. Hinds, E. A. Hinds, Jeremy M. Hutson and Tanya Roussy and has published in prestigious journals such as Science, Physical Review Letters and Nature Physics.
